The United States Strategic Bombing Survey
http://www.anesi.com/ussbs02.htm#eaocar

The U. S. Army Air Forces entered the European war with the firm view that
specific industries and services were the most promising targets in the
enemy economy, and they believed that if these targets were to be hit
accurately, the attacks had to be made in daylight. A word needs to be said
on the problem of accuracy in attack. Before the war, the U. S. Army Air
Forces had advanced bombing techniques to their highest level of development
and had trained a limited number of crews to a high degree of precision in
bombing under target range conditions, thus leading to the expressions "pin
point" and "pickle barrel" bombing. However, it was not possible to approach
such standards of accuracy under battle conditions imposed over Europe. Many
limiting factors intervened; target obscuration by clouds, fog, smoke
screens and industrial haze; enemy fighter opposition which necessitated
defensive bombing formations, thus restricting freedom of maneuver;
antiaircraft artillery defenses, demanding minimum time exposure of the
attacking force in order to keep losses down; and finally, time limitations
imposed on combat crew training after the war began.

It was considered that enemy opposition made formation flying and formation
attack a necessary tactical and technical procedure. **Bombing patterns
resulted -- only a portion of which could fall on small precision targets.**
The rest spilled over




on adjacent plants, or built-up areas, or in open fields. Accuracy ranged
from poor to excellent.** When visual conditions were favorable and flak
defenses were not intense, bombing results were at their best.
Unfortunately, the major portion of bombing operations over Germany had to
be conducted under weather and battle conditions that restricted bombing
technique, and accuracy suffered accordingly. Conventionally the air forces
designated as "the target area" a circle having a radius of 1000 feet around
the aiming point of attack. While accuracy improved during the war, Survey
studies show that, in the over-all, only about 20% of the bombs aimed at
precision targets fell within this target area. A peak accuracy of 70% was
reached for the month of February 1945. These are important facts for the
reader to keep in mind, especially when considering the tonnages of bombs
delivered by the air forces. Of necessity a far larger tonnage was carried
than hit German installations.
